The room that sells the property
Kitchens carry more weight than any other room, whether a buyer is walking through, a tenant is deciding between two units, or you are the one cooking in it every night. They are also the most coordination-heavy renovation in a house: cabinets, counters, appliances, plumbing, electrical, flooring and finish work all have to land in the right order.
A large number of Cincinnati kitchens were laid out when kitchens were closed-off work rooms with a single window and one outlet. Opening those spaces up, or simply fitting a dishwasher and a modern range into them, is often more about the framing and the electrical than about the cabinets.

Coordinating the parts that hold up kitchens
Most kitchen delays are not labor delays. They are cabinet lead times, countertop templating that cannot happen until cabinets are set, and appliances that arrive in the wrong week. Velocity manages that sequence as part of the project rather than treating it as your problem.

Can you change the kitchen layout, or only replace what is there?
Both are on the table. Keeping the existing layout is the least disruptive and least expensive route. Moving the sink, range or refrigerator changes plumbing, electrical and sometimes framing, so we price that separately and explain the difference before you decide.
Do you install cabinets I have already ordered?
Yes. Some clients order cabinets themselves and have us handle demolition, prep and installation. Tell us the manufacturer and delivery date and we will build the schedule around it.
How long will I be without a kitchen?
It depends on the scope and material lead times — cabinets and countertops are usually what set the schedule, not the labor. We give you a realistic window after the walkthrough, and we sequence the work so the kitchen is not sitting open waiting on a delivery.
What is the most cost-effective kitchen update for a rental?
Usually a combination of durable flooring, fresh paint, refinished or replaced cabinet fronts, new counters and updated fixtures. It changes how the unit shows without the cost of relocating plumbing.
Do you handle countertops?
Yes — we coordinate templating and installation with the countertop supplier as part of the project schedule so it does not become a separate thing for you to chase.
